#5: These guys are predatory and have eight legs and are easily recognized by the pair of grasping claws and the narrow, segmented tail, often carried in a characteristic forward curve over the back, ending with a venomous stinger. They range in size from 9 mm to 20 cm. They are widely distributed over all continents, except Antarctica, in a variety of terrestrial habitats except the high latitude tundra. They number about 1,752 described species with 13 families recognized to date.
